4-[1,2-bis[bis(carboxymethyl)amino]ethyl]benzenediazonium

Also Known As: Azophenyl-edta, Azo-phenyl-edta, EX-A16619, Benzenediazonium, 4-(1,2-bis(bis(carboxymethyl)amino)ethyl)-, 4-[1,2-bis[bis(carboxymethyl)amino]ethyl]benzenediazonium

CAS: 53641-65-9
Molecular Formula C16H19N4O8+
Molecular Weight 395.12 g/mol
LogP 0.15468
Topological Polar Surface Area 183.83 Ų
Hydrogen Bond Donors 4
Hydrogen Bond Acceptors 7
Rotatable Bonds 12
Exact Mass 395.1203
Heavy Atoms 28
Complexity 741.84406

Chemical Identifiers

CAS Number 53641-65-9
SMILES C1=CC(=CC=C1C(CN(CC(=O)O)CC(=O)O)N(CC(=O)O)CC(=O)O)[N+]#N

Property Insights of azophenyl-EDTA

The XLogP value of 0.15468 suggests moderate lipophilicity, balancing water solubility and membrane permeability for azophenyl-EDTA. The TPSA of 183.83 Ų indicates high polarity, suggesting azophenyl-EDTA may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, azophenyl-EDTA has 4 hydrogen bond donor(s) and 7 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
